I have been back to the UK and had my test done:

my fasting results was 6.5
my glucose results was 5.6
(yes I have them the right way round)

I have lost nearly a stone in weight.

But my HbA1c is 10% Now I believe that is high...I have been diagnosed 3 weeks nearly 4 what else do I have to do to bring this HbA1c DOWN... I am SO peed off worked so so hard!!!

Thanks

David
 
Your HbA1c is a measure of your levels over the last 3 months, so when you have your next one, with all your hard work, it will have come down.
